MCMC lauded for innovation at Malaysia Technology Excellence Awards 2026

National network intelligence platform MCMC Nexus and immersive learning initiative MetaHRise earn top honours, highlighting data-driven regulation and talent development

KUALA LUMPUR – The Malaysian Communications and Multimedia Commission (MCMC) has been recognised in the Analytics – Telecommunications category at the Malaysia Technology Excellence Awards 2026 for its pioneering national network intelligence platform, MCMC Nexus.

The platform enhances the monitoring and management of connectivity performance across Malaysia, reflecting MCMC’s commitment to data-driven regulation and improved telecommunications service quality nationwide.

MCMC Nexus transforms crowdsourced mobile measurements into actionable insights, enabling real-time network performance monitoring. This allows for precise identification of connectivity gaps, supports targeted interventions, and contributes to ongoing service improvements for Malaysians.

A standout feature of the platform is its Auto Alert function, which aligns with Malaysia’s Mandatory Standards for Quality of Service (MSQoS). “It enables early detection of potential service degradation and facilitates timely engagement with Mobile Network Operators (MNOs),” MCMC said.

Built with strict privacy-by-design principles, MCMC Nexus ensures all data remains anonymised. The Personal Data Protection Department (JPDP) confirmed that the platform does not collect personal information, using only anonymous network performance data in compliance with Malaysia’s data protection laws.

Malaysian Communications and Multimedia Commission (MCMC) Commissioner Derek Fernandez speaking at the Malaysia Technology Excellence Awards 2026. – MCMC pic, April 3, 2026

At the same awards ceremony, MCMC’s Human Capital Division received recognition in the Augmented Reality and Virtual Reality – Government Organisation category for MetaHRise, an immersive learning initiative designed to strengthen capability development through experiential learning. The initiative highlights MCMC’s efforts to integrate emerging technologies into staff training and talent development.

These accolades underscore MCMC’s ability to create high-impact, homegrown regulatory technology while reinforcing its dedication to innovation, internal capability development, and data-driven regulation in advancing Malaysia’s digital ecosystem.

The Malaysia Technology Excellence Awards, organised by Asian Business Review, celebrate companies at the forefront of technological innovation and digital transformation, recognising their contribution to Malaysia’s rapidly growing economy. – April 3, 2026
